Preventing urushi wicking into crackle glaze during kintsugi repair

A wood-fired ceramic bowl with heavy ash-glass craquelure is broken into four pieces plus a hairline crack. The practitioner needs to join and fill the pieces with urushi but fears the lacquer will wick along the crackle lines and permanently darken them, especially because the crazing reaches the fragment edges where masking tape cannot seal the sides.

Safety

Ki-urushi (raw lacquer) is a potent skin sensitiser. Contact can cause a delayed urushiol-type dermatitis that may appear 12–72 hours after exposure and can become progressively more severe with repeated contact. Gloves, long sleeves, and avoidance of skin contact are essential when handling the sap, especially in the thin-edge-sealing and crack-filling steps described here.

What the thread establishes

The answer.

The thread converges on a two-part priming strategy. First, the raw edges of each fragment are sealed with an extremely thin coat of ki-urushi and allowed to cure; this both limits later absorption and improves adhesion when the pieces are assembled. Second, the glazed faces are primed with prepared egg-white glair, applied thin enough to be visible pulling into the craquelure, wiped of excess, and left to dry for a day or two before any urushi is applied to the surface. Masking tape is retained as a supplementary barrier but is acknowledged as insufficient on its own. For the hairline crack the practitioner must apply just enough urushi (possibly ethanol-diluted to improve capillary flow) to fill the fissure while accepting that some wicking into the surrounding glaze is unavoidable.

What goes wrongUrushi wicks along the craquelure lines and darkens them. Masking tape placed over the surface does not prevent this because the crackle channels run to the very edges of the fragments, so lacquer enters from the sides regardless of the tape on top. The problem is recognised by the characteristic darkening of the fine crackle network after urushi contact.

What recovers itThe thread does not describe a method for reversing urushi staining once it has wicked into the glaze. The emphasis is entirely on prevention through the glair priming and edge-sealing steps before any decorative or structural urushi is applied.

01

Seal fragment edges with ki-urushi

Dab an extremely thin, even layer of ki-urushi along the broken edges of each fragment. Allow it to cure fully. This limits later absorption and promotes adhesion when the pieces are joined.

02

Prepare egg-white glair

Process the egg whites using a method that increases their fluidity (the commenter references a glair-for-painting preparation), so the liquid can seep into the fine craquelure channels.

03

Prime the glazed surface with glair

Apply the glair thinly over the glazed faces. It should be thin enough that you can watch it being drawn into the crackle lines. Wipe off the excess, then let it dry for a day or two before proceeding.

04

Apply masking tape as a supplementary barrier

Even after glair priming, place masking tape over areas where urushi will be worked, to reduce the chance of any residual staining. The tape is a secondary safeguard, not the primary one.

What was reported

  • Craquelure on wood-fired pottery will wick urushi into the crack lines and darken them.
  • Masking tape placed over the surface is insufficient when the craquelure reaches the fragment edges, because urushi enters from the sides.
  • Egg-white glair, prepared to be sufficiently fluid, can be used to prime and seal craquelure channels before urushi application.
  • Sealing the broken edges with a thin coat of ki-urushi before assembly both limits absorption and improves later adhesion.
  • The susceptibility of a given glaze to urushi wicking depends on firing temperature, sodium content, and the type and quantity of ash present.
  • Masking fluid can be used as an alternative barrier but may itself stain certain clay bodies.
  • For a hairline crack, ethanol dilution of ki-urushi can improve capillary flow into the fissure.
  • Practising on unglazed terracotta pots is advisable before working on a finished glazed piece.
Disputed

Whether to use straight ki-urushi or ethanol-diluted ki-urushi for the hairline crack

The thread does not settle this
  • Some tutorials recommend applying straight ki-urushi to the hairline crack.
  • Other tutorials recommend diluting the ki-urushi with ethanol so it wicks more readily into the narrow fissure.

Limits of this source

What the thread does not answer.

  • Whether straight ki-urushi or ethanol-diluted ki-urushi gives a stronger, more durable fill in a hairline crack on a glazed surface; the thread presents both options without resolving which is preferable.
  • What, if anything, can be done to remove or mask urushi staining that has already wicked into the craquelure after the fact.
  • The specific firing history of the bowl (temperature, ash composition, sodium content) remains unknown, so the exact degree of wicking susceptibility cannot be predicted.
